Shanghai-based SenseTime demos chatbot SenseChat, available in Chinese and English, image tool Miaohua, and video tool Ruying, powered by its SenseNova LLM

Context & Ripple Effects

SenseTime is jumping into the generative-AI race from Shanghai with a full stack demo: the chatbot-and-content-tool pattern other Chinese companies would later ship publicly, here split across a bilingual SenseChat assistant, an image generator (Miaohua), and a video tool (Ruying), all running on one homegrown foundation model, SenseNova. The timing matters — Alibaba Cloud's unveiling of Tongyi Qianwen and plans to embed it across DingTalk and Tmall Genie landed the very next day, marking April 2023 as the moment China's big platforms stopped watching ChatGPT and started answering it.

The lineage runs deeper than this news cycle: Microsoft's [[a:831533|Xiaoice had already proven Chinese-language conversational AI at 20M registered users back in 2015]]. What changed is that the underlying models are now large enough to power text, image, and video from a single lab — and for SenseTime, whose stock was down more than 80% since its 2021 Hong Kong IPO at the time, SenseNova became the narrative it would keep building on, culminating in the 30%+ share surge when the latest SenseNova version debuted a year later.

First-order effects

  • SenseTime now competes head-to-head with Alibaba Cloud's Tongyi Qianwen in the same week, and unlike Alibaba it has no flagship consumer product like DingTalk to distribute through — SenseChat, Miaohua, and Ruying must find their own audience.

Second-order effects

  • Alibaba's plan to push its chatbot into every product sets the distribution benchmark rivals must answer: standalone demos like SenseChat risk losing to assistants embedded where users already work.

Third-order effects

  • The September approvals that let Baidu, ByteDance, and peers roll out chatbots publicly show Beijing acting as gatekeeper for who reaches consumers — labs like SenseTime that build state-compatible models are positioned to survive that filter.

The trend: China's AI labs are converging on ChatGPT-style assistant suites built on proprietary LLMs, with regulatory approval becoming the decisive competitive moat over raw model quality.
